Enhancing Customer Experiences One of the most visible applications of LLMs is in customer service. By integrating LLMs into chatbots and customer support systems, companies can provide more responsive and personalized interactions. These AI systems can handle inquiries efficiently, learn from interactions to improve over time, and escalate complex issues to human agents when necessary. The result is a streamlined process that maintains high levels of customer satisfaction while reducing operational costs. In retail, LLMs are used to provide tailored shopping experiences. They analyze customer data to offer personalized recommendations, enhancing user engagement and increasing conversion rates. Furthermore, their natural language capabilities allow for seamless voice and text interaction, enabling brands to engage with customers more naturally. Revolutionizing Content Creation The content creation industry is witnessing a significant transformation with the advent of LLMs. Writers and marketers leverage these models to generate drafts, brainstorm ideas, and even create entire articles or marketing materials. This use of AI in content creation allows professionals to focus on creativity and strategy, leaving routine tasks to the machine. Moreover, LLMs are being used to automate the creation of user manuals, product descriptions, and other repetitive content. This automation not only speeds up production but also ensures consistency in tone and style, which is particularly beneficial for companies managing large catalogs of information. Scientific Research and Data Analysis In the realm of scientific research, LLMs assist in literature review and data analysis. Researchers use these models to comb through vast amounts of academic papers and extract relevant information efficiently. This capability accelerates the research process, helping scientists stay up to date with the latest developments in their fields. LLMs also facilitate data driven research by interpreting complex datasets and generating insights. This application is particularly useful in fields like genomics and climate science, where massive amounts of data require sophisticated analysis. By automating data interpretation, scientists can focus on hypothesis testing and discovery. Bridging Language Barriers Language translation and localization are other areas where LLMs make a significant impact. Companies operating globally utilize these models to translate content into multiple languages, ensuring their message reaches broader audiences. With advanced understanding of context and nuance, LLMs provide translations that are often more accurate and culturally relevant than traditional software. In addition to translation, LLMs are enhancing accessibility by transcribing and summarizing spoken content in real time. This feature is invaluable in international conferences and meetings, making information accessible to participants regardless of language proficiency.
